Description

From an ancient vineyard, dry farmed in Alexander Valley, this wine is a relic of the past. Planted in 1894, the vines are still going strong, grafted onto St. George rootstock. Blended with Syrah that was planted later in 1968 and offers a savory component to the fruity blend.

RECENT TASTING NOTES
Barbara Banke purchased the Field Stone estate in 2016, bringing its ancient petite sirah vines—survivors from 1894—into the Jackson Family Wines portfolio. Graham Weertsharvested the fruit from those vines when it still retained freshness, its dark flavors brisk and austere as a cold desert night. There’s a green note of agave to the flavors of deepredpeach and black-skinned blueberry, the fruit filling a vast tannic structure, remarkably nimble for a wine of this size. It’s the kind of wine that’s so big you can’t really take all of it in at once, but it’s not overpowering or heavy, just mysterious and anxious to rest in the cellar for years.
Joshua Greene, Wine & Spirits, 6/2020
